Care Instructions for Rayon Fabrics

When it comes to caring for rayon fabrics, gentle handling is key. To preserve their quality and extend their lifespan, follow these simple yet crucial steps:

Washing: Wash your rayon garments inside out using cold water (below 30°C or 86°F). This will prevent shrinkage, fading, and color bleeding. Use a mild detergent that’s specifically designed for delicate fabrics.

Drying: Remove excess moisture by gently squeezing the fabric without wringing it. Reshape the garment to its original dimensions and lay it flat on a clean towel to air-dry. Never hang rayon garments to dry, as this can cause stretching or distortion.

Ironing: Iron your rayon garments while they’re still slightly damp. Use a low heat setting (avoid steam) and a pressing cloth to prevent scorching. If you must iron a rayon garment that’s completely dry, use a cool iron and keep it moving constantly to avoid burning the fabric.

Remember, gentle care is essential for maintaining your rayon garments’ beauty and longevity. Avoid machine drying or high heat settings, as these can cause damage and affect their texture and appearance.

Cellulose Regeneration Process

The cellulose regeneration process is a critical aspect of rayon production that has significant environmental implications. The process involves dissolving wood pulp or cotton linters in a chemical solution to break down the lignin and extract the cellulose fibers. However, this process requires substantial amounts of water – approximately 150-200 liters per kilogram of rayon produced.

Energy consumption is another concern, as the production of rayon requires significant amounts of electricity to power the machinery. Chemical requirements also play a crucial role in the regeneration process, with various chemicals used to dissolve and purify the cellulose fibers. The most commonly used solvent is carbon disulfide (CS2), which has raised concerns about its environmental impact due to its toxicity and potential health risks.

To mitigate these concerns, some manufacturers are exploring more sustainable alternatives, such as using recycled or plant-based solvents. Additionally, implementing efficient water management systems and reducing energy consumption through renewable sources can also help minimize the environmental footprint of rayon production.
